Former MLA Peddi Sudarshan Reddy’s health remains critical

Former Narsampet MLA and senior BRS leader Peddi Sudarsan Reddy continues to be under intensive treatment at Yashoda Hospital after suffering a massive pulmonary embolism. Doctors said he remains on mechanical ventilation and neurological assessment will continue after the observation period

Hyderabad: Former Narsampet MLA and senior BRS leader Peddi Sudarsan Reddy continues to receive intensive treatment at Yashoda Hospital in Secunderabad after being shifted from a private hospital in Warangal following a massive pulmonary embolism that led to hemodynamic collapse and shock.

According to a health bulletin issued by the hospital on Tuesday, Sudarsan Reddy was revived after multiple rounds of CPR and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S), following an estimated 45 minutes of downtime. After initial thrombolysis in Warangal, he was shifted to Yashoda Hospital for advanced critical care.


The hospital said he is being treated by a multidisciplinary team comprising specialists in critical care, pulmonology, cardiology and neurology. His blood pressure and vital parameters are being maintained with minimal support, while he remains on mechanical ventilation.

Doctors said there has been no meaningful neurological response to verbal or painful stimuli since admission despite the absence of sedatives. EEG, MRI brain and CT scans indicated features suggestive of anoxic brain injury. A comprehensive neurological reassessment is scheduled after completion of the 72-hour observation period to better assess his prognosis.

Sudarsan Reddy’s family has been kept informed about his condition and prognosis on a continuous basis, the bulletin said.
